Addressing Water Filling Problems
Water filling troubles in washing home appliances most frequently originate from a breakdown within either the water inlet shutoff or the stress button. The valve controls the amount of water to the equipment, while the pressure switch informs the device when it has actually reached the appropriate level. If the valve is damaged or the stress button is defective, it can result in inaccurate water levels; either filling up excessive or too little.

One technique of repairing includes by hand filling the maker with water. If the machine operates usually when manually filled, the problem likely lies within the water inlet valve. Conversely, if an excessive quantity of water enters the equipment despite getting to the established level, the stress switch is most likely the culprit. It is important for house owners to follow the particular guidelines and safety precautions given by the manufacturer when evaluating these parts, or think about getting the aid of a professional.

Attending To Drainage Issues
When a laundry equipment experiences drainage troubles, one typical indication is water remaining inside the appliance also after a laundry cycle ends. This concern can be triggered by different factors such as an obstructed or kinked drainpipe pipe, or a defective drain pump. Recognizing these normal causes is important for identifying and resolving the underlying concern successfully. If water continues to gather regardless of several rinse attempts, it is vital to act quickly to prevent water damages or the development of mold.

Adopting an organized method to address water drainage interruptions can yield sufficient results. To start with, an aesthetic inspection of the drainpipe hose can disclose possible blockages or physical damage. If clearing the obstruction or correcting a curved hose pipe does not provide a resolution, it may be time to consider a malfunctioning drain pump, which might require expert maintenance or replacement. Moreover, mindfully keeping track of any type of error code that appears on the home appliance's console throughout the cycle can provide important insights relating to the nature of the disturbance. An appliance manual can assist in deciphering these mistake messages, further assisting in determining the exact problem.

Taking Care Of Problems with Drum Turning
Running into a drum that will not rotate is a frequent trouble that can occur with your washing maker. This problem usually shows a mechanical trouble, frequently related to the electric motor, belts, or lid button. The electric motor is accountable for driving the spinning movement in your washing machine, so if it's damaged or faulty, the drum will not rotate. Also, dysfunctional belts or cover buttons can also restrain the drum's movement.

Figuring out the origin of a non-spinning concern can be a daunting job, yet it's an important step in fixing the trouble effectively. To begin, check the cover switch for any kind of signs of damages or wear. You can quickly verify if the cover button is the wrongdoer by paying attention for an unique clicking audio when opening and closing the cover. If the sound is lacking, replacing the cover switch might be necessary. In many cases, damaged belts or worn out motors may need a much more thorough evaluation by an expert. Keep in mind, safety should constantly be your leading priority when working with electric or mechanical components, so make sure the washer is unplugged prior to checking any parts.

Fixing Insufficient Cycle Troubles
Usually, the deal with laundry home appliances isn't limited to simply water filling up or draining pipes out, but it transcends to a lot more complex issues like incomplete cycles. This takes place when the washing equipment stops randomly at any kind of factor throughout its wash, rinse or spin cycles. This discouraging misstep can be an outcome of a variety of elements from a malfunctioning timer or control panel to cover switches over not functioning properly. In addition, if the appliance's motor is overheating or the water level switch is malfunctioning, these can also contribute to the disruption of the device's normal cycle.

Resolving this issue needs a careful diagnostic procedure to establish the root of the problem. Start by conducting a simple examination of the cover button, as deterioration in time could cause it to quit operating Laundry Aplliance Repair appropriately. Moving along, inspect the water level switch; if it is defective, it can send out inaccurate signals to the maker regarding when to start and stop. You may additionally want to examine the device's control board and timer. If they are defective, the machine could either quit mid-cycle or otherwise start at all. Please remember that this sort of repairing need to be carried out with caution as electrical power is included, and if you are not sure regarding any step of the process, it is recommended you consult a trained professional.

Fixing Too Much Noise and Vibration Worries
Too much noise and resonance from your laundry home appliance can show several prospective concerns, varying from an unbalanced tons to a malfunctioning element within the equipment. Frequently brought on by irregular circulation of clothes, vibrations can be quickly dealt with by stopping the cycle and redistributing the load within the drum. Nevertheless, if the sound and resonance linger, it could be due to worn out or loose drive belts, drum bearings, or motor.

To detect precisely, a person may need to manually check the mentioned parts for any indicators of wear or damages and change any type of malfunctioning elements promptly. If your device is consistently making loud noises, in spite of your attempts at load redistribution, it's strongly advised to get in touch with a specialist. A certified service technician will certainly have the skills and knowledge to determine and fix the root of the trouble, ensuring your maker operates smoothly and quietly. It's important to resolve these concerns without delay, as long term resonances or noises might create additional damages to your device or environments.
